#cplusplus Electrobun lets you build ultra-fast, tiny desktop apps in TypeScript for macOS, Windows, and Linux. Start with `npx electrobun init` for quick templates, get ~12-14MB bundles using system webviews and Bun runtime, and send tiny 14KB updates via bsdiff patches. It offers typed RPC for main-webview communication, fast startup under 50ms, and full tools for building, signing, and shipping. You benefit by coding once in familiar TypeScript, skipping Electron's bloat or Tauri's Rust, to ship performant apps in minutes with easy distribution and low user downloads. https://github.com/blackboardsh/electrobun

https://github.com/riga/tfdeploy Google's TensorFlow framework is taking off big-time now that it's at a full 1.0 release. One common question about it: How can I make use of the models I train in TensorFlow without using TensorFlow itself? #Tfdeploy is a partial answer to that question. It exports a trained TensorFlow model to "a simple #NumPy-based callable," meaning the model can be used in Python with Tfdeploy and the the NumPy math-and-stats library as the only dependencies. Most of the operations you can perform in TensorFlow can also be performed in Tfdeploy, and you can extend the behaviors of the library by way of standard Python metaphors (such as overloading a class). Now the bad news: Tfdeploy doesn't support GPU acceleration, if only because NumPy doesn't do that. Tfdeploy's creator suggests using the gNumPy project as a possible replacement. #Machine_learning
